Lately, the circles underneath my eyes have been scaring me. Too many hours staring at the computer, not enough sleep, too much coffee—you get it.
Once upon a time, I would leave the house for work with just lipstick and some mascara. Those days are long gone.
These days, one of the first products I turn to is La Mer's Radiant Concealer.
It's creamy and goes on easy—no brush required. In addition to having an SPF 25, it has some sort of miracle treatment ingredients in it that are actually lightening my dark circles. What's more is, it doesn't leave that cakey, obvious concealer look (we all know the look).
The only downside is the price. A 3.5 gram-sized product costs $65. Still, you don't need much, and I am guessing it will last one year—or more.
For less expensive concealers, look for one with a creamy consistency and ideally one that has sunscreen. The creaminess is key in order for the concealer to blend well.
